This perfectly situated, west-facing, detached, 2+1 bedroom family home is located just steps from the Queensway and Islington. A large 44.33 x 115.33 foot lot includes a huge backyard for entertaining nestled in one of Toronto’s most desirable neighbourhoods! This popular area is one of the fastest growing and most highly regarded neighbourhoods in Toronto. An ideal residential property, 23 Loma Road is a detached bungalow family home on a child-friendly street, with lots of potential to customize, renovate and extend back. 23 Loma Road boasts many upgrades and features such as original hardwood floors, open-concept kitchen, a master suite over-looking a backyard for entertaining and garden shed, a lower level with seperate entrance, family room, a 3rd bedroom, laundry room, 2nd bathroom, and additional storage. This lovely family home offers the peace of mind and safety of a true neighbourhood, close to great schools, dining, local shops, private drive for 4 cars, and easy access to the Queensway and QEW. Schools: Norseman Jr. • Etobicoke School of the Arts • St. Louis Elementary Catholic • Our Lady of Sorrows Catholic • BishopAllen Academy • Alderwood Toronto Private • Kingsway College • Humberside Montessori • Holy Angels Catholic • St. Leos Catholic Transit: Queensway motorists can travel to downtown Toronto's financial and entertainment districts in approximately ten minutes via the Gardiner Expressway. For commuters heading west of the city the Queen Elizabeth Way can be immediately accessed off Islington Avenue. Bus service on Royal York Road and on Islington Avenue connect passengers to stations on the Bloor-Danforth subway line.
